# ast -- import "github.com/robertkrimen/otto/ast" Package ast declares types representing a JavaScript AST. ### Warning The parser and AST interfaces are still works-in-progress (particularly where node types are concerned) and may change in the future. ## Usage #### type ArrayLiteral ```go type ArrayLiteral struct { LeftBracket file.Idx RightBracket file.Idx Value []Expression } ``` #### func
